This Amendment No. 11 amends and supplements the Schedule 13D filed on
May 24, 1996, and amended on July 3, 1996, by Kimco Realty Corporation, a
Maryland corporation ("Kimco"), and Milton Cooper and further amended on May 15,
1997, June 10, 1997, April 30, 1998, September 20, 1999, August 10, 2000, August
23, 2000, August 9, 2001, January 31, 2003 and August 3, 2004 by Kimco, Milton
Cooper and Kimco Realty Services, Inc., a Delaware corporation ("Services") (as
amended, the "Schedule 13D"), relating to the common shares of beneficial
interest, par value $.01 per share (the "Shares"), of Atlantic Realty Trust, a
Maryland corporation (the "Company"). Unless otherwise indicated, all
capitalized terms used herein shall have the meanings given to them in the
Schedule 13D, and unless amended or supplemented hereby, all information
previously filed remains in effect.

ITEM 4. PURPOSE OF THE TRANSACTION
Item 4 is hereby amended to add the following:
The Company had previously announced that a special committee of the
Board of Trustees (the "Special Committee") was considering acquisition
proposals for all of the Shares or all or substantially all of the Company's
assets. In connection with its evaluation of acquisition proposals, the Special
Committee requested that Kimco and other potential bidders, if interested,
submit proposals to acquire either the Shares or the Hylan Center (as defined in
the Schedule 13D). Kimco has submitted a non-binding indication of its interest
in acquiring the Hylan Center (the "Proposal"). The Proposal is conditioned upon
satisfactory completion of due diligence, negotiation of acceptable
documentation, and any necessary regulatory approvals. The Proposal may be
withdrawn or modified by Kimco at any time for any reason.
The Company has not accepted the Proposal, and there can be no
assurance as to the Company's view of the Proposal, whether the Proposal will be
accepted, whether any definitive agreement will be entered into if the Proposal
is accepted, nor as to the terms of any such agreement or ensuing transaction.
The Proposal is attached hereto as Exhibit 8 and incorporated by reference
herein.
Kimco, Services and Milton Cooper each reserves the right, based on
all relevant factors, and in each case subject to the provisions of the
Standstill Agreement (as defined in the Schedule 13D), to acquire additional
Shares, to dispose of all or a portion of its holdings of Shares, to modify,
amend or rescind the Proposal, to make any alternative proposals with respect to
an acquisition of Shares or assets of the Company, a merger, a reorganization or
any other extra-ordinary transaction involving the Company or its assets, or to
change its intention with respect to any or all of the matters referred to in
this Item 4.

Kimco Realty Corporation ("Kimco") is pleased to submit this preliminary,
non-binding indication of interest ("Proposal") for the acquisition of the Hylan
Plaza Shopping Center (the "Center"). This proposal is based on the Offering
Memorandum, your letter to us dated January 14, 2005, and the other information
you have provided to us regarding the Center and Atlantic Realty Trust (the
"Trust") and supercedes the proposal dated February 9. 2005.
Kimco is a leading retail REIT specializing in the acquisition, development, and
management of neighborhood shopping centers. Kimco is the nation's largest
publicly traded owner and operator of neighborhood and community shopping
centers, with interests in 750 properties in 42 states, Canada and Mexico,
comprising approximately 112 million square feet of leasable space.
VALUE
Based upon the information received, Kimco believes the value of the Center, on
a debt free basis, is $84,000,000 (the "Purchase Price"). Our purchase price is
net of $1,000,000 that we estimate we will be required to spend for near term
capital expenditures after the closing.
CONSIDERATION
Under our Proposal, we will issue Kimco common stock in the amount of the
Purchase Price to the Trust. Our goal in structuring the transaction would be to
achieve a tax-free transaction for the Trust and its shareholders.
STRUCTURE
Our Proposal contemplates that the Center would be acquired from the Trust on a
debt and liability-free basis in a transaction which would permit the Kimco
common stock to be received tax free to both the Trust and its shareholders. Our
Proposal would have the Trust transfer the Center to Kimco for Kimco stock and
the remaining assets and liabilities will be transferred to a liquidating trust
(the "Liquidating Trust"). We have assumed that the Trust's only liabilities are
certain tax liabilities that are being contested that are related to its
predecessor and, other than the Center, the Trust' only asset is cash in excess
of such liabilities and that our proposal will qualify as a tax free
reorganization.
Kimco and its affiliates, as holders of approximately 37% of the outstanding
common stock of the Trust, would not be supportive of any transaction involving
the Trust or the Center which is not tax free to both the Trust and its
shareholders.
Based on our conversations with you, we have structured our Proposal as an
acquisition of the Center for stock; however, we are amenable to discussing
alternative structures including an acquisition of the Trust or a transaction in
which shareholders would have the option to receive cash.
FINANCING
Kimco's common stock is listed on the New York Stock Exchange and is widely
traded.
EARNEST MONEY DEPOSIT
We would be willing to deposit $500,000 (the "Initial Deposit") into an escrow
account upon signing a mutually satisfactory definitive agreement. The Initial
Deposit would be fully refundable if we terminate the definitive agreement for
any reason during a 15 day inspection period which would commence as soon as we
enter into exclusive negotiations (the "Inspection Period"). Upon completion of
the Inspection Period we would increase the deposit to $4,000,000 as an advance
against the Purchase Price. Any deposits would be refunded on the consummation
of the transaction and the delivery of the Kimco stock.
CONTINGENCIES AND APPROVALS
Kimco's interest is conditioned upon satisfactory completion of due diligence,
negotiation of acceptable documentation, and any necessary regulatory approvals.
We have attached a list of required due diligence materials relating to the
Center as Exhibit A, in addition we would depending on the structure of the
transaction also anticipate certain limited additional due diligence requests
with respect to the Trust. We do not anticipate any difficulties or delays in
obtaining any necessary corporate or regulatory approvals.
TIMING
We are confident that we can negotiate a definitive agreement very quickly and
would be able to complete due diligence within the 15 day Inspection Period.
